Pytania oznaczone «bash»

11
Indeksowanie i modyfikowanie tablicy parametrów Bash $ @

Czy można odwoływać się do indeksów w $@? Nie mogę znaleźć żadnego odniesienia do użycia, takiego jak nigdzie indziej w wiki GrayCata , a Advanced Scripting Guide i inni przypisują to do innej zmiennej przed jej zmodyfikowaniem. $ echo ${@[0]} -bash: ${@[0]}: bad substitution Celem jest OSUSZANIE...

11
Jak korzystać - jako alias?

Kiedy korzystałem z openSUSE 11.3, przyszedł on z kilkoma już skonfigurowanymi aliasami. Dwa, z których często korzystałem, były +dla pushd .i -dla popd. Teraz w Debianie nie mogę wymyślić, jak stworzyć drugi. alias -=popdpróbuje odczytać -=jako opcję polecenia aliasu. Próbowałem umieścić wokół...

11
Wymuszanie „dodanego” aliasu do każdego polecenia

Czy można przymusowo dodać alias czasu (z braku lepszego sposobu wyrażenia go) do każdego polecenia w bash? Na przykład chciałbym mieć konkretnego użytkownika, który za każdym razem, gdy uruchamiane jest polecenie, zawsze jest zawinięte dateprzed i po nim lub time. Czy to możliwe, a jeśli tak, to...

11
Nieblokująca komenda bash

Powiedzmy, że mam skrypt bash z następującymi elementami: #!/bin/sh gedit rm *.temp Kiedy wykonuję go za pomocą sh ./test.sh, geditwyskakuje okienko, ale rmczęść nie działa dopóki nie zamknę gedit. Chcę, aby skrypt nadal działał, nawet jeśli geditnie jest zamknięty; jak geditnie blokuje...

11
Czy wypełnianie zakładki BASH wypełnia pierwszy mecz?

Czy jest jakiś sposób, aby BASH wypełnił pierwsze dopasowanie po naciśnięciu klawisza TAB, podobnie jak wiersz polecenia systemu Windows? (Powinien nadal wyświetlać listę dopasowań, ale powinien przełączać się między nimi, gdy naciskam klawisz Tab.) czyli celem jest, aby być w stanie wypełnić w...

11
Jak ograniczyć liczbę linii dostępnych w poleceniu bash?

Zacząłem pobierać duży plik w tle, używając $ nohup wget http://example.tld/big.iso & co daje mi również nohup.outplik zawierający dane wyjściowe wget. Teraz, jeśli później chcę obejrzeć proces pobierania, mógłbym użyć, $ tail -f nohup.outale to wypełnia okno terminala szybciej, niż bym...

11
Dwa polecenia, jeden potok

Potrzebuję tych dwóch poleceń, aby były jednym (aby móc przesyłać je dalej): dig +nottlid -t any bix.hu | egrep -v "^;;|^;|^$" | sort dig +nottlid -t any www.bix.hu | egrep -v "^;;|^;|^$" | sort Mam na myśli, że potrzebuję, aby dane wyjściowe tych dwóch poleceń znajdowały się w jednym potoku:...

11
Zmapować klucze bash vi?

Używam Dvoraka i vi, więc kiedy dowiedziałem się o trybie vi w Bash, byłem bardzo podekscytowany. Byłoby jednak jeszcze lepiej, gdybym mógł zmienić mapowanie klawiszy ruchu, aby były tymi, których używam w vi (zamieniam klucze, dopóki klucze ruchu nie wrócą do domowego rzędu w Dvorak). W jaki...

11
Dziwne zachowanie w $ (nazwa katalogu `readlink -f $ 0`)

Gdy uruchamiam następujące funkcje jako zwykły użytkownik, wszystko jest w porządku: $(dirname `readlink -f $0`) ale po przejściu na root wystąpił następujący błąd: readlink: invalid option -- 'b' Try `readlink --help' for more information. dirname: missing operand Try `dirname --help' for more...

11
Jak działa uzupełnianie ścieżki Bash w sudo?

Uzupełnianie ścieżki tabulatorów nie działa (przynajmniej w Ubuntu i AFAIK Arch) z sudo mount <whatever> Plik ISO, który próbuję zamontować, nie istnieje /etc/fstab. Jeśli tylko piszę mount <whatever> zakończenie działa (ale oczywiście polecenie kończy się niepowodzeniem, ponieważ...